臂工具削減代碼,保持性能
深層技術介紹了深層DRT,描述為一個完整的軟件開發(fā)環(huán)境的基于ARM皮層嵌入式系統(tǒng)。
據該公司介紹,與其他解決方案不同,深層的新測序技術提供了更大的優(yōu)化空間,導致更短的開發(fā)時間,提高性能和降低相關成本。
早期測試表明,可以實現代碼的大小減少20%以上對性能沒有任何影響。
深層DRT考慮不僅設備的處理器元素,而且其底層內存系統(tǒng)。
因此代碼生成流的每個元素是充分意識到目標設備的,除了那些可能導致優(yōu)化傳統(tǒng)的工具和技術。
完全自動化,不需要人工干預,因此不需要源代碼分析器反饋或更改。結果是更小、更快、更高效和更少的電力餓設計,生產時間和減少程序員工作。
“嵌入式系統(tǒng)開發(fā)人員必須確保軟件按時并在預算之內完成生產,同時使它盡可能精簡和最大化其有效性,”戴夫·愛德華茲,深層的創(chuàng)始人、首席執(zhí)行官和首席技術官。
“深層DRT區(qū)分自己從傳統(tǒng)軟件開發(fā)工具通過其專利未決device-aware測序優(yōu)化。這些分析整個程序,識別所有指令和數據序列,以及它們之間的相互作用發(fā)生的硬件,”他繼續(xù)說。”,因為這一過程發(fā)生在現有的編譯器應用優(yōu)化技術,它建立在傳統(tǒng)的編譯器優(yōu)化,和方便地集成到代碼生成流而不需要修改。”
撥碼開關http://www.orunapp.cn |